| Abstract: |
| The effect of Sodium Polyacrylate (SP) on the runoff and sediment yield was studied by the field simulated rainfall experiment.For the SP application amount, runoff and sediment yield intensity, the relationship model was built.The results showed that, there was a quadratic relationship between the SP application amounts, the time of producing runoff and the average intensity of runoff yield, respectively.But a straight-line relationship with the sediment yield intensity was found.When the SP application amount is 0 to 2.42 g/m2, especially 1.21 g/m2, SP delayed the runoff yield on slope.Therefore, SP increased the soil infiltration and decreased the runoff yield, as the application amount is 0 to 3.31 g/m2, especially 1.65 g/m2.SP can affect the surface runoff process.While the amount was 1.8 g/m2, the increase of the initial run-off was reduced in the dosage of 3.6 g/m2.And, the runoff process line was very close to the control, while the application rate increased to 5.4 g/m2, the intensity of runoff increased significantly.With the application rate increasing, the sediment yield intensity was gradually reduced. |
